How to Choose a Mesothelioma Law Firm

The top mesothelioma law firms have expertise in representing asbestos victims across the country. They have a track record of success winning compensation for the victims to help pay for medical treatments and lost wages as well as provide ongoing care.

They will make the lawsuit process as easy as possible for the clients, so that they can concentrate on their treatment and spending time with loved ones. A mesothelioma lawyer will be present at court hearings and manage the details involved in filing claims.

Experience

The best mesothelioma law firms have years of experience bringing asbestos lawsuits. They know what is required for victims to be compensated and how to build solid cases that will help them recover the money needed to pay for treatment and lost wages and other expenses. They know how to negotiate with insurance companies to ensure that victims receive the maximum settlement.

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er must be competent to answer any questions asbestos patients and their families have about the legal procedure. They should explain all the different types of compensation available and how to qualify for each type of settlement. They should be able to inform victims if they have to pay tax on the settlement.

Mesothelioma patients and their families should be represented by a team of committed professionals who are determined to fight for the rights of their clients. Jury Verdicts

Most mesothelioma lawsuits settle without court proceedings, but if the defendants and plaintiff are unable to reach a settlement, the case will proceed to trial. At the trial, plaintiffs and their lawyers present evidence before a judge and jury. The judges and juries will decide if a victim should be awarded compensation.

Mesothelioma patients are qualified for compensatory and punitive damages. Compensatory damages are meant to compensate for financial losses, like lost wages, medical costs and funeral expenses. Punitive damages are given to victims in order to punish the company and deter future asbestos-related mishaps.
